Concrete foundation leveling services involve assessing and correcting uneven or settling foundations to restore stability and proper alignment. The process typically includes identifying areas where the concrete has shifted, cracked, or sunk, and then employing specialized techniques to lift and stabilize the affected sections. These services aim to ensure the foundation remains level, preventing further structural issues and maintaining the integrity of the property. Professionals may use methods such as slab jacking or polyurethane foam injection to achieve a smooth, level surface.
Addressing foundation unevenness helps resolve a variety of problems that can compromise a property's safety and functionality. Common issues include cracked walls,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the concrete. Left untreated, these problems can worsen over time, leading to costly repairs and potential safety hazards. Foundation leveling services can mitigate these risks by restoring the foundation’s proper position, which supports the overall structure and prevents further damage.

Cost of Concrete Foundation Leveling - The typical cost range for foundation leveling services varies from $1,500 to $5,000, depending on the extent of the settlement and the size of the foundation. For example, small residential projects may be closer to $1,500, while larger or more complex jobs can approach $5,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Pricing - The overall cost depends on factors such as soil conditions, foundation type, and accessibility. In Grain Valley, MO, prices may fluctuate within the standard range based on these variables, with some projects costing less or more accordingly.
Average Cost for Local Pros - Local contractors typically charge between $3 and $10 per square foot for foundation leveling services. For a typical 1,500-square-foot home, this could translate to approximately $4,500 to $15,000, depending on the specific requirements.
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include permits, structural repairs, or drainage improvements, which can add to the total expense.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ific foundation conditions in Grain Valley, MO.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ation leveling? Concrete foundation leveling involves adjusting and stabilizing a sunken or uneven foundation to restore its proper position and prevent further damage.
How do professionals determine if my foundation needs leveling? Contractors typically assess the foundation through visual inspections and measurements to identify signs of settling or unevenness.
What methods are used for foundation leveling? Common techniques include mudjacking and polyurethane foam lifting, which can raise and stabilize settled concrete slabs.
How long does foundation leveling usually take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the settling, but most projects can be completed within a day or two.
Is foundation leveling a suitable solution for all types of cracks? Foundation leveling is effective for addressing uneven slabs and certain types of cracks,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ine the appropriate approach.
